"Echo" (38) - TIE Phantom
Push The Limit (3), Fire Control System (2), Intelligence Agent (1), Stygium Particle Accelerator (2)

Something similar was mentioned on another thread. The key is after decloak you get the free evade action which can trigger ptl. You have of course dialled in a green manoeuvre to clear the stress for another action. So decloak > evade action > ptl action > stressed > green manoeuvre > normal action

I've taken that RAC, with the addition of the Dauntless title, with the below Quickdraw to two top cuts in the Store Champs season (the only two store champs I've made it to). It's an absolutely solid choice, and I suspect Quickdraw outperforms most of the above, due to survive-ability, lethal-ness, and the ability to trigger Kylo.

Quickdraw
A Score to Settle (Helps get those crits against the most troublesome ship)
FCS
Pattern Analyzer (for clutch sloops and one hards)
Title
LWF

That & Dauntless leaves you with one point for initiative. Honestly, though, it is very, very rare that I care about initiative, as I can make either work to my benefit with this list. And, more often than not, my opponent gives me my preferred initiative anyways.

This idea has been around for a long time, but there's a reason you don't see it often. Its kind of dumb, frankly!

Losing Advanced Cloaking Device, just to be able to triple action once (stress free) is actually not a good trade-off. You see, Stygium means uncloaked for the rest of the shooting phase (and the subsequent planning phase) and both Whisper and Echo thrive on being able to cloak every turn! That is what makes them powerful. But by all means, try it out and see for yourself.
